Unlike your regular drill bits, the parabolic flute design has a unique shape. The flutes, those spiral grooves on the bit, are wider and deeper as they get closer to the shank. This isn&#8217;t just for show; it serves some pretty important functions.<\/p>\n<p>One of the biggest advantages of a parabolic flute wood drill bit is its chip evacuation. When you&#8217;re drilling into wood, chips are produced. If these chips aren&#8217;t removed properly, they can clog the drill bit, slow down the drilling process, and even cause overheating. With the parabolic flutes, the chips are quickly and efficiently carried out of the hole. The wider and deeper flutes near the shank provide more space for the chips to move, and the shape of the flutes helps to push the chips up and out. As I mentioned earlier, when chips clog the drill bit, it can cause overheating. Overheating is bad news for both the drill bit and the wood. It can dull the bit quickly, and it can also burn the wood, leaving unsightly marks. The efficient chip evacuation of the parabolic flutes helps to keep the bit cool. With less heat, the bit stays sharp for longer, and you get a cleaner, more professional-looking hole.<\/p>\n<p>Let&#8217;s talk about the cutting action of these bits.
